We are seeking a highly motivated and skilled Cloud Security Researcher to join our team.

The candidate should have the ability to work on a team and alone, and poss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ills

On a typical day you'll:

Conduct research on new capabilities for the cloud security domain.
Work with multiple teams inside the company to enrich current capabilities and develop further advanced methods to improve those capabilities.
Monitor and evaluate emerging cloud security technologies and make recommendations for their adoption.
Collaborate with the team to develop new ideas and push them further in the organization for implementation.
Perform security assessments and identify vulnerabilities in cloud infrastructure and applications.
Recommend and implement security controls to mitigate identified risks.
Provide expertise on security best practices and technologies related to cloud security.
Publish research via blog, tutorials, articles and conference talks.

About you:
At least 2 years of experience in the cyber security domain
Deep knowledge of attacker's tactics, techniques, and procedures
Ability to think outside of the box and bring new ideas to the table
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ail
Strong communication and collaboration skills
Ability to work both independently and as a team player
Open-minded approach to thinking outside of the box

Preferred Qualifications:
Experience in Penetration Testing / Incident Response & Detection Engineering / Threat hunting / Malware analysis
Knowledge of cloud security technologies and tools in any or all major cloud providers (AWS, Azure, GCP)
